* usb: storage: Drop unnecessary check in usb_stor_blk_io()Andrey Smirnov2019-03-111-27/+0
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Checking that sector_count is zero, shouldn't be necessary since block layer won't call this function if there's no data to be read. Drop it. Checking that blockbits is eqal to SECTOR_SHIFT isn't necessary, since that field is filled by the driver and is not changed outsied of it. We know it is going to be SECTOR_SHIFT. Drop it. Checking sector_start > (ulong)-1 doesn't make sense at all since sector start is 'int' and it can't possibly be greater that ULONG_MAX. Drop it. Checking for sector_start >= pblk_dev->blk.num_blocks isn't necessary either, since we shouldn't receive request for invalid read from block layer. Drop it. Ditto for sector_count > INT_MAX and sector_start + sector_count > pblk_dev->blk.num_blocks. * usb: storage: Don't use "unsigned long" for 32-bit valuesAndrey Smirnov2019-03-111-3/+3
| | | | | | | | | | Unsignled long will expand to 64-bit unsigned integer on 64-bit CPUs. This will break current code using it to read out two 32-bit values returned by READ_CAPACITY. Fix the proble by using "u32" explicitly. Signed-off-by: Andrey Smirnov <andrew.smirnov@gmail.com> Signed-off-by: Sascha Hauer <s.hauer@pengutronix.de>

* USB: introduce usb_interface/usb_configuration structsSascha Hauer2014-07-181-12/+12
| | | | | | | | | | | Currently we have two conflicting definitions of struct usb_config_descriptor and struct usb_interface_descriptor in the tree. This is because the USB code uses additional fields in the structs for internal housekeeping. Add struct usb_interface and struct struct usb_configuration with the housekeeping data and embed the corresponding hardware structs into them. This frees the way to use the definitions from ch9.h in the next step. Signed-off-by: Sascha Hauer <s.hauer@pengutronix.de>
